Also a couple breakfast ideas for when you need to be quick (I have three running around myself) would be cottage cheese mixed with cantaloupe and strawberries, broken up walnut halves or use the cottage cheese, walnuts and apples diced and add cinnamon. You can make a few days worth at at time. Crustless quiche can be made with bacon and tomato, spinach, broccoli or asparagus, cheese of choice (swiss, feta and cheddar are all great) a little half and half or cream. You can split it into 6 slices and just stick one each in a ziplock bag. Set out a couple days worth and freeze the rest just thaw the night before so you can toss it in the microwave. That's at least a couple fast breakfast ideas.
